Duncan V9L 3E1 Website Design and Programming
Duncan British Columbia V9L 3E1
Duncan British Columbia
PostalCode 48.781592 Longitude -123.677271
Website Design, Programming, SEO and Lead Generation
Duncan British Columbia V9L 3E1
Duncan British Columbia
PostalCode 48.781592 Longitude -123.677271